MONROVIA, Liberia (AP) — Election officials in Liberia on Monday formally declared Joseph Boakai the president-elect, three days after incumbent George Weah conceded defeat based on the runoff vote's provisional results.

According to the 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ø Elections Commission, Boakai won with 50.64% of the second round balloting while Weah took 49.36%.
